LPT Aperture Holdings acquires Speculo AI platform

1 week ago 19

LPT Aperture Holdings, parent company of LPT Realty and Aperture Global Real Estate, acquired Speculo, an AI-powered database engagement and intent-detection platform built for real estate professionals, the company announced. Speculo, founded in 2024 by Riley VanderKaay and Bobby Moats, will keep its own brand and remain brokerage agnostic while expanding its reach across the U.S. and Canada, according to the announcement. Financial terms of the deal were not disclosed. The acquisition fits LPT Aperture Holdings’ (LPTA) strategy of investing in independent, industry-facing growth platforms that can support a range of residential real estate businesses, from solo agents to teams and larger enterprises. Speculo joins other brokerage-agnostic offerings in LPTA’s portfolio, including Reside and AI tools like dezzy.ai. Speculo’s core product is Remi, an AI “teammate” that works inside a brokerage or team’s existing database to engage clients, detect changes in consumer intent and flag when human outreach is most likely to create value.
